Position Summary

The Healthcare Construction Superintendent is responsible for the overall field supervision, coordination, safety, quality control, and schedule management of healthcare construction projects. Projects may include hospitals, medical office buildings, surgical centers, laboratories, behavioral health facilities, and occupied healthcare renovations. The Superintendent ensures all work is completed in accordance with project specifications, California HCAI (formerly OSHPD) requirements, infection control standards, and applicable building codes.

Essential Responsibilities

  • Manage all day-to-day field operations for healthcare construction projects.
  • Coordinate and supervise subcontractors, vendors, inspectors, and field personnel.
  • Develop, maintain, and enforce project schedules to ensure timely completion.
  • Ensure compliance with California HCAI/OSHPD regulations, healthcare codes, and project specifications.
  • Coordinate inspections with the Inspector of Record (IOR), HCAI representatives, and local authorities.
  • Implement and enforce Infection Control Risk Assessment (ICRA) procedures, containment protocols, and interim life safety measures.
  • Lead project safety programs and maintain OSHA compliance.
  • Conduct daily jobsite meetings, safety meetings, and subcontractor coordination meetings.
  • Monitor quality control and ensure all work meets contract documents and healthcare facility standards.
  • Review drawings, specifications, RFIs, submittals, and construction documents for field execution.
  • Manage site logistics, material deliveries, equipment utilization, and workforce planning.
  • Track project progress and prepare daily reports, look-ahead schedules, and punch lists.
  • Coordinate project turnover, commissioning, closeout documentation, and owner training.
  • Build and maintain positive relationships with owners, architects, engineers, healthcare staff, and project stakeholders.
